Section 3
INSTALLATION OF THE BANkS SIx-GUN & BANkS BRAkE SWITCH
CAUTION: Do not use excessive
force when working on plastic
parts. Permanent damage to the
part might result.
1.
Remove the center Finish Panel by
removing the two (2) screws behind
the screw panel covers and pulling out
on the panel. Disconnect any electrical
connectors. See Figure 16.
2.
Remove four (4) screws that hold
the instrument cluster in place. See
Figure 17. Retain hardware for reuse.
3.
Apply the parking brake and put
the vehicle in the lowest gear possible.
Remove the instrument cluster by
pulling out. Disconnect any electrical
connector.
4.
cut out the template in
Figure 24 on page 32, and tape to the
front of the instrument cluster panel
as shown in Figure 18. The template
will be used as a guide for drilling the
holes to locate the Banks Six-Gun and
Banks Brake switch.
If you are only installing a Six-Gun
switch, skip Step 5 and use only the
bottom hole in the template.
5.
Remove the plastic honeycomb
pattern from the back of the cluster
panel around the top hole to make
sufficient room for the switch. See
Figure 19. to ease process use a
die grinder to remove the plastic
honeycomb pattern.
6.
If only installing a Six-Gun
switch, only use the bottom hole
in template. Using a
